It is with sympathy, the management and staff of Slater's Funeral Home, Inc. announce the passing of Mr. Robert Densley, Milledgeville, Georgia. Mr. Densley passed away on Monday, June 27, 2022.
Graveside services were held on Saturday, July 2, 2022 at 2:00 PM from the Torrance Chapel Baptist Church Cemetery, Milledgeville, Georgia.
On February 16, 1943 in Gordon, Georgia, Robert Louis Densley was born to the union of the late Mr. Willie Ike Densley and the late Ms. Leila Mae Simmons Densley.
He was preceded in death by his parents and son, Roy White. At an early age he joined Torrance Chapel Baptist Church. He attended public schools in New York City and Baldwin County. He was a retired worker of T&S Hardwood.
Robert was known by some as “Kid” and by his grandkids as “Rocky”. Robert was fortunate to share his birthday with his niece. He was a very good swimmer and skater. He loved country music, westers, oh and I can't forget his boots! He also loved being a dad, grandad, brother, uncle, but most of all he was a proud great granddad.
He is survived by his daughter, Marcia Williams, of Milledgeville, Georgia; son, Tyrone (Melinda) White, of Milledgeville, Georgia; grandchildren, Tyronica Barnes and Hakeem Durden both of Milledgeville, Georgia; great grandchildren, Genecia Barnes and Hakeem Durden Jr., both of Milledgeville, Georgia; sisters, Rosa L. Webster, Lucile (Timothy) Veal, of Milledgeville, Georgia; brothers, Alvin Densley, John (Yvetta) Densley of Chicago, Illinois and Richmond Densley of Milledgeville, Georgia, a host of nieces, nephews, and friends. Special appreciation for his devoted granddaughter, Tyronica Barnes and a devoted niece, Sandra Kendrick.
